| """
 | |
| Parallel clang-tidy runner
 | |
| ==========================
 | |
| 
 | |
| Runs clang-tidy over all files in a compilation database. Requires clang-tidy
 | |
| and clang-apply-replacements in $PATH.
 | |
| 
 | |
| Example invocations.
 | |
| - Run clang-tidy on all files in the current working directory with a default
 | |
|   set of checks and show warnings in the cpp files and all project headers.
 | |
|     run-clang-tidy.py $PWD
 | |
| 
 | |
| - Fix all header guards.
 | |
|     run-clang-tidy.py -fix -checks=-*,llvm-header-guard
 | |
| 
 | |
| - Fix all header guards included from clang-tidy and header guards
 | |
|   for clang-tidy headers.
 | |
|     run-clang-tidy.py -fix -checks=-*,llvm-header-guard extra/clang-tidy \
 | |
|                       -header-filter=extra/clang-tidy
 | |
| 
 | |
| Compilation database setup:
 | |
| http://clang.llvm.org/docs/HowToSetupToolingForLLVM.html
 | |
| """
